Considering purchasing a Mustang Summit one piece seat and trunk pad for my 2015 Electra Glide Ultra Classic Low. Does anyone have this setup on their EG? Pictures would be great. Any experience or advice would also be appreciated.
That looks like the equivalent seat for the new models as the Super Touring Seat was for the pre-Rushmores.
I have the Super Touring and I love it. Super comfortable... I've ridden nearly 1200 miles in a single day.
Like a previous poster mentioned, it moves you back nearly 2 inches. I needed that 2 inches. If you're less than 6' tall that 2 inches may not be desirable.
The only thing that could make it even better, and this is only my opinion, is that it doesn't need to be as wide as it is. If it were 2-4 inches narrower it would look nicer. I don't think my *** will ever get wide enough to fill the seat LOL.
